The official stats for poverty and deprivation in Ireland for 2018 were released today by the CSO. In this episode of SJI's Ten Minute Lessons, Social Justice Ireland's Economic & Social Analyst Eamon Murphy looks at the headline poverty numbers, explains where they come from, and why they're measured as they are.
The purpose of our SJI's Ten Minute Lessons series is to educate and inform listeners on a particular area of policy, giving a brief overview (somewhere in the range of 8 to 15 minutes) and hitting on the key points that people need to know.
